AMD Ryzen 5 7535U vs AMD Ryzen 5 7520U
Comparative analysis of AMD Ryzen 5 7535U and AMD Ryzen 5 7520U processors for all known characteristics in the following categories: Essentials, Performance, Memory, Compatibility, Peripherals. Benchmark processor performance analysis: PassMark - Single thread mark, PassMark - CPU mark.
Differences
Reasons to consider the AMD Ryzen 5 7535U
- CPU is newer: launch date 3 month(s) later
- 2 more cores, run more applications at once: 6 vs 4
- 4 more threads: 12 vs 8
- Around 6% higher clock speed: 4.55 GHz vs 4.3 GHz
- Around 50% more L1 cache; more data can be stored in the L1 cache for quick access later
- Around 50% more L2 cache; more data can be stored in the L2 cache for quick access later
- 4x more L3 cache, more data can be stored in the L3 cache for quick access later
- Around 31% better performance in PassMark - Single thread mark: 3197 vs 2442
- Around 86% better performance in PassMark - CPU mark: 16955 vs 9139

Reasons to consider the AMD Ryzen 5 7520U
- Around 87% lower typical power consumption: 15 Watt vs 28 Watt
